------------------------------------Building You Farm------------------------------------
~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~Feel Free To Post Questions~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
Try to avoid the farm animals, trees, and decorations.
Why?
These take up space where you can build a crop that gives you more exp(in time) more cash(quicker) and you are able to plant several different things.
Should I be "careful" on what i plant?
Yes, you should pick the crop that best fits your schedule. For example, if your going to be gone for a few hours you don't want to plant a crop that ends in a few minutes; this would just be a waste of time and money.
Should I water my neighbors and communities farms?
You don't have to but you should. This is why: If you take a few seconds to water a neighbors farm they probably will do the same for you another time. Watering helps because it gives extra $cash$ and experience to that farmer.


Note(s):
-Plowing Cost $10 and gives you 1 exp
-Watering Plants: You don't water you own plants, only other users can water your plants for you... you can get a better rating by watering other people's farms. (which will helps by showing your farm more often in the community farms then the lower ratings) You do this by visiting their farm and double clicking on their plants which haven't already been watered. The ones that have been watered will have water droplets above the section.


------------------------------------------Crops------------------------------------------
-Strawberry: Cost $0, Profit +$30, Exp +1, 5 mins

-Corn: Cost $35, Profit +$115, Exp +4, 1 day

-Carrot: Cost $25, Profit +$80, Exp +1, 3 hours

-Bell Pepper: Cost $30, Profit +$90, Exp +2, 12 hours

-Raspberry: Cost $0, Profit +$20, Exp +0, 1 min

-Tomato: Cost $50, Profit +$200, Exp +3, 16 hours

-Grape: Cost $85, Profit +$220, Exp +2, 8 hours

-Rice: Cost $70, Profit +$280, Exp +5, 3 days

-Onion: Cost $45, Profit +$210, Exp +4, 1 day

-Lemon Cucumber: Cost $65, Profit +$240, Exp +3, 16 hours

-Pomegranate: Cost $60, Profit +$170, Exp +2, 12hours

-Wheat: Cost $75, Profit +$265, Exp +5, 2 days

-Cabbage: Cost $100, Profit +$250, Exp +2, 6 hours

-Potato: Cost $120, Profit +$345, Exp +4, 1 day

-Blackcurrant: Cost $60, Profit +$165, Exp +1, 4 hours

-Spinach: Cost $105, Profit +$405, Exp +5, 2 days

-Broccoli: Cost $120, Profit +$295, Exp +2, 8 hours

-Watermelon: Cost $150, Profit +$320, Exp +2, 12 hours

-Red Quinoa: Cost $130, Profit +$535, Exp +6, 4 days


-----------------------------------------Trees-----------------------------------------
-Apple Tree: Cost $100, +$10 every 1 day

-Orange Tree: Cost $750, +$50 every 36 hours

-Lemon Tree: Cost $1,000, +$80 every 2 days

-Cherry Tree: Cost $2,300, +$70 every 1 day


---------------------------------------Animals---------------------------------------
-Sheep: Cost $200, +$30 every 12 hours, Exp +2

-Corgi: Cost 55(gems), +$40 every 1 day, Exp +140

-Chicken: Cost $50, +8$ every 6 hours, Exp +1

-Pig: Cost $500, +$35 every 18 hours, Exp +6

-Cow: Cost $800, +40 every 20 hours, Exp +10


---------------------------------------Decorations---------------------------------------
-Bench: Cost $1,000, Exp +10

-Hay Bale: Cost $300, Exp +4

-Mailbox: Cost $500, Exp +6

-Barn: Cost $120,000, Exp +1,500

-Farm House: Cost $200,000, Exp +2,500

-Tool Shed: Cost $90,000, Exp +1,100

-Feed Trough: Cost $1,000, Exp +15

-Wooden Crate: Cost $300, Exp +4

-Lantern: Cost $2,000, Exp +30

-Wine Barrel: Cost $3,000, Exp +40

-Outhouse: Cost $10,000, Exp +125

-Butter Churn: Cost $2,500, Exp +30

-Woodpile: Cost $2,000, Exp +30

-Grain Silo: Cost $30,000, Exp +375



-Garden Gnome: Cost 15(gems), Exp +50

-Water Pump: Cost 10(gems), Exp +30

-Bird Bath: Cost 8(gems), Exp +25

-Scarecrow: Cost 22(gems), Exp +75

-Water Trough: Cost 4(gems), Exp +15

-Sundial: Cost 18(gems), Exp +60

-Bird House: Cost 6(gems), Exp +20


---------------------------------------Landscape---------------------------------------
-Fence(s): Cost $500, Exp +6

-Flagstone: Cost $400, Exp +5

-Brick Path: Cost $600, Exp +8

-Hedge: Cost $1,500, Exp +19


---------------------------------------Enhancements---------------------------------------
.......Expansions........
11x11- Cost 20(gems) or $10,000
12x12- Cost 20(gems) or $40,000
13x13- Cost 20(gems) or $150,000

.......Other.......
$5,000 for 10(gems)
$50,000 for 100(gems)
Fertilizer[1x1] for 1(gems)
Fertilizer[Entire Farm] for 20(gems)
